Global Blood Collection Market (USD Million), 2021 - 2031

In the year 2024, the Global Blood Collection Market was valued at USD 7,687.09 million. The size of this market is expected to increase to USD 11,635.09 million by the year 2031, while growing at a Compounded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 6.1%.

The Global Blood Collection Market represents a crucial segment within the broader healthcare industry, playing a pivotal role in ensuring adequate blood supply for medical treatments, transfusions, and diagnostic procedures worldwide. Blood collection encompasses a range of processes, from donor recruitment and phlebotomy to blood processing, testing, and storage. The market's significance stems from its direct impact on patient care, emergency response systems, and healthcare delivery across various medical specialties. With a growing emphasis on blood safety, quality assurance, and personalized medicine, the Global Blood Collection Market continues to evolve, driven by technological advancements, regulatory standards, and changing healthcare practices.

Key factors driving the Global Blood Collection Market include rising healthcare demand, increasing prevalence of chronic diseases, and expanding geriatric populations requiring blood transfusions and related services. Moreover, advancements in blood collection technologies, such as automation, closed systems, and point-of-care testing, are enhancing efficiency, accuracy, and patient safety in blood collection processes. The market also benefits from initiatives promoting voluntary blood donation, public awareness campaigns, and partnerships between healthcare institutions and blood collection agencies. These efforts contribute to maintaining a reliable and sustainable blood supply chain, crucial for addressing medical emergencies, surgeries, and therapeutic interventions.
